Medial hamstring reflex tests which nerve root?

S1

S2

L4

L5

The medial hamstring reflex primarily tests the integrity of the L5 nerve root. This reflex is elicited by tapping the hamstring tendon, which principally engages the semitendinosus and semimembranosus muscles. These muscles receive innervation from the sciatic nerve, which is formed from both the L4 and L5 nerve roots, but the L5 component is critically involved in the reflex response.

When assessing reflexes, the specific nerve roots are associated with certain muscle groups, and in the case of the medial hamstring, the L5 nerve root plays a significant role in its function. The reflex pathway includes not only the sensory neuron that conveys the stimulus but also the motor neuron that produces the response, both of which are linked to the L5 nerve root.

Understanding the anatomy and functional significance of the nerve roots can help in the interpretation of reflex tests during a neurological examination, enabling the clinician to pinpoint potential areas of nerve dysfunction or injury.
